Strawberry And Red Onion Salad With Poppy Seed Dressing
- Salad Dressing
- 1/3 cup canola oil
- 3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
- 2 tablespoons water
- 1 1/2 tablespoons honey (slightly warmed to help in blending)
- 1 tablespoon poppy seed
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
- Salad
- 1 pint fresh strawberries, stemmed and halved
- 1 small red onion, sliced and cut into crescents
- loose leaf lettuce
- Salad Dressing: In small non-reactive bowl, combine the salad dressing ingredients. Blend thoroughly using an immersion blender and set aside. Best prepared 1 hour in advance of serving.
- Salad: To assemble salads, line four individual serving plates with the lettuce.
- Arrange strawberries and onion crescents, equally divided, on the lettuce leaves.
- Whisk dressing before serving and serve on side.
